如何在 Clash 中开启代理

目录

  1. 什么是 Clash
  2. 为什么需要开启代理
  3. Clash 的安装步骤
  4. Clash 的配置文件设置
    • 第一步:寻找配置文件
    • 第二步:编辑配置文件
    • 第三步:管理代理群组
  5. 如何在 Clash 中开启代理
    • 使用 GUI 界面
    • 使用命令行(CLI)
  6. FAQ
    • Clash 与其他代理工具的比较
    • Clash 的使用场景
    • 如何 Troubleshoot 代理问题
  7. 总结

1. 什么是 Clash

Clash 是一个广受欢迎的跨平台代理工具,特别是在科学上网的活动中,因其丰富的功能和强大的配置灵活性而受到使用者的青睐。通过配置不同的规则,使得用户可以轻松切换节点并控制网络流量。

2. 为什么需要开启代理

打开代理的主要好处包括:

  • 隐私保护:通过代理隐藏真实 IP 地址。
  • 访问限制内容:突破地理限制,能够访问目标网站或服务。
  • 加速网络:优选路由,提高访问速度。

3. Clash 的安装步骤

  • 第一步:访问 Clash 的 GitHub 页面,下载适合你的操作系统的二进制文件。
  • 第二步:将下载的文件放入指定目录,确保目录的路径已添加到系统环境变量中。
  • 第三步:运行 Clash,检查是否正常工作。

4. Clash 的配置文件设置

第一步:寻找配置文件

默认情况下,Clash 的配置文件通常位于以下路径:

  • Windows:C:\Users\用户名\.config\clash\config.yaml
  • macOS/Linux:~/.config/clash/config.yaml

第二步:编辑配置文件

使用文本编辑器打开 config.yaml

常见的配置项包括:

  • port:设置代理服务器使用的端口。(默认为 7890)
  • proxy:添加代理节点信息。

第三步:管理代理群组

  • config.yaml 中,确保创建相应的 proxy_group ,根据需要组配置相应的策略(如 url-test, reserve 等)。
  • 这将方便在不同情况下选择不同的网络路由。

5. 如何在 Clash 中开启代理

使用 GUI 界面

  1. 打开 Clash 客户端,你会看到一个简单易用的界面。
  2. 点击右上角的网络控制菜单,选择’Direct’或‘Proxy’。
  3. 根据需要选择已配置的节点进行代理。

使用命令行(CLI)

  1. 打开命令行终端,进入到 Clash 的安装目录。
  2. 运行 clash -p 7890 -f config.yaml 启动建好的代理。
  3. 使用你的应用程序,通过设定 socks5 地址(如:127.0.0.1:7890)便可以正常访问互联网。

6. FAQ

Clash 与其他代理工具的比较

  • Clash 和 Shadowsocks:Clash 提供多协议支持,能够实现 Shadowsocks、Vmess、Trojan 等协议的代理;相对而言,Shadowsocks 的功能较为单一。
  • Clash 和 V2Ray:V2Ray 适合对系统环境影响较小,而 Clash 可能更适合那些需要简单快速配置用户。

Clash 的使用场景

  • 游戏加速:通过不同的代理节点加快游戏响应。
  • 科学上网:绕过防火墙,实现自由访问。
  • 测试开发:在多个地域进行接口测试。

如何 Troubleshoot 代理问题

  1. 确保配置文件正确,使用 YAML 验证工具确保没有语法错误。
  2. 检查网络连接状态,保证网络可用,访问正常。
  3. 查看 Clash 日志,根据日志信息定位问题所在。

7. 总结

在 本文中,我们探讨了如何在 Clash 中开启代理的详细步骤,包括相关配置文件的设置和如何管理代理群组。这让你能够通过 Clash 这个强大的代理工具,更好的享受网络自由。如有疑问,欢迎参考 FAQ 部分或在社区寻求帮助。

正文完
 0